Bus and Truck Mechanics and Diesel Engine Specialist Salary Information in Minnesota

The average annual salaries for bus and truck mechanics and diesel engine specialists in the state of Minnesota are shown in Table 1. The comparison of the salary statistics of bus and truck mechanics and diesel engine specialists amongst Minnesota cities is shown in Table 2. The salary statistics are based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1 & 2. Annual Salary of Bus and Truck Mechanics and Diesel Engine Specialists in Minnesota (2022 Survey)

Percentile bracketAverage annual salary
10th Percentile Wage
$40,120
25th Percentile Wage
$49,600
50th Percentile Wage
$60,000
75th Percentile Wage
$71,720
90th Percentile Wage
$81,250

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for bus and truck mechanics and diesel engine specialists in Minnesota in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$81,250.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$60,000.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ent is $40,120.

Table 3. Median Annual Salary of Bus and Truck Mechanics and Diesel Engine Specialists in Minnesota Cities (2022 Survey)

Table 3 shows the median annual salary of bus and truck mechanics and diesel engine specialists in some Minnesota cities and metropolitan areas. We note that the median annual salary of bus and truck mechanics and diesel engine specialists in state of Minnesota ranges from $48,310 to $60,190. The highest paying area for bus and truck mechanics and diesel engine specialists in Minnesota is Rochester with a median annual salary of $60,190. The second highest paying city/area in Minnesota State is St Cloud (mean annual salary $58,260). The lowest paying area is Northwest Minnesota nonmetropolitan area with a median annual salary of $48,310.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Rochester
$60,190
St Cloud
$58,260
Mankato-North Mankato
$58,200
Northeast Minnesota nonmetropolitan area
$56,940
Southeast Minnesota nonmetropolitan area
$50,610
Southwest Minnesota nonmetropolitan area
$49,600
Northwest Minnesota nonmetropolitan area
$48,310
